Comments (6)
I don't know how to merge my modifications to my fork. I pasted my solution into gist.github.com/hz, 360995 is a interface, 360996 is request featured with failover and pooling. 360997 is the wrapper for thrift api. 30999 is the revised keyspaceimpl. you do some tricks on getColumn. I can not solve it.
After the clean wrapper of thrift api, this issue will be solved.
from hector.
Sorry, it's pretty hard to see diffs in gists. It's preferable that you push back to your hz/hector repo so I can see diffs and send line comments, but if this isn't working for you, then email me a patch
from hector.
Any idea when this problem is likely to be resolved? Occasionally I experience a transport error which causes the call to getKeyspace to fail. When this happens Hector does not recover and all subsequent calls to getKeyspace fail.
from hector.
I guess I was just waiting for someone to need this bad enough to implement that...
If you're not into hacking that I'll try to find some time for it this week
from hector.
Well, http://github.com/Mishail/hector/commit/a8c9a0accd49d1e8f76ad15d8250f608f8a9d755
Though I'm not sure that all is done properly... The code is mostly borrowed from CassandraClusterImpl. And all unit-test are passed (except one, which I marked as @ignore and specified the reason)
from hector.
fixed on master e5f29a4..1bf8ab5 master -> master
from hector.
Related Issues (20)
- clock should get in a static way in HConnectionManager HOT 2
- HLocks configuration should allow a definable gc_grace seconds, instead of using default 10s HOT 2
- Clients wait indefinitely when pool exhausted HOT 2
- MicrosecondsClockResolution produces timestamps out of long range
- Wiki points to http://hector-client.org/
- Trivial improvements to *pom.xml HOT 2
- Upgrade dependency API usage to remove use of deprecated code
- me.prettyprint.hector.api.exceptions.HectorTransportException: Unable to open transport to (192.168.1.6):9160 HOT 2
- in 1.0.3 When many request come to hecotor pool . more than one node have problem.
- getting data from cassandra, column name from cassandra trailing with blank characters HOT 5
- DynamicLoadBalancingPolicy: LatencyAwareHClientPool may throw NoSuchElementException under certain circumstances HOT 1
- CQL 3 not supported
- Implement consistent logging for setters in me.prettyprint.cassandra.model.ConfigurableConsistencyLevel
- No Documentation available for Hector with SSL HOT 3
- Memory problem on ConcurrentHClientPool using HThriftClient with TFramedTransport HOT 3
- No failover policy when coordinating through partitioned off nodes
- Connecting to Cassandra does not ask for credentials
- hector 1.1-4 throws TimedOutException() execute_cql_query_result.read on Cassandra 2.1.12
- default validator comparator type on hector clients: "cannot parse 'SomeColumn' as hex bytes" HOT 3
- Copyright claim in HFactoryTest.java? HOT 1
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from hector.